Profile Image

Alex Smith Doe

Senior WordPress Developer

Does a computer engineer needs to know web design?

IT Service Providers
Best Managed IT Services Providers
IT Service Provider For Small Business

Does a computer engineer need to know web design? We are living a digital age, and with so many complex devices and technologies available, this is an important question to answer. Does a computer engineer need to understand web design when writing and developing code for a given system? Will knowledge of web design help them to be further success in the field? Could an engineering degree be augmented with knowledge of web design to give a competitive edge?

There is evidence that computer engineering studies are often incomplete when it comes to topics beyond coding. Studies have found that although computer engineering students receive instruction in coding and programming, they may lack necessary skills such as creative problem-solving and an understanding of user experience design, both of which web design encompass. As such, a computer engineer may find themselves handicapped when tasked with producing a product which requires these skills.

In this article, you will learn why knowledge of web design is fundamental for a computer engineer and how to take advantage of this relationship. It will cover topics such as the principles of web design, the necessary skills for basic competence, what it takes to become a successful web designer, and what a web designer must understand in order to be able to work effectively with a computer engineer.

By offering valuable insight into the benefits of learning web design, this article will provide computer engineers with clear direction on how to develop their own ability to design websites and applications in a creative and effective manner, enabling them to better collaborate with web designers and provide the right tools for their needs.

Does a computer engineer needs to know web design?

Defining Computer Engineering and Web Design

Computer engineering is a discipline that focuses on the design, development, construction, and maintenance of all kinds of computing systems and software. It requires an in-depth understanding of how computer technology works and how best to appropriately utilize it to meet specific requirements. Generally, computer engineers have a broad knowledge of computer hardware and software and an understanding of the principles behind them.

Web design is the discipline dealing with the aesthetics and usability of websites, including coding, graphics, aspects of usability, and more. It is an important part of web development, which incorporates many areas of creating, building, and maintaining websites. A web designer needs to know how to create an attractive website that is both eye-catching and functional, with strong visuals and user-friendly navigation.

So does a computer engineer need to know web design? To some degree, yes. As mentioned, computer engineers have a broad knowledge of computer hardware and software, so they may have the technical understanding of web development and design. However, while knowledge of web design and development may not be absolutely necessary, a computer engineer may find it to be of benefit to their work. Knowledge of basic web development and design will help them stay aware of the current trends and best practices in the industry, and they may even find web development and design a useful skill to have in their work.

To sum up, computer engineers have a comprehensive understanding of computing systems and software, and web design is a discipline that focuses on the aesthetics and usability of websites. While it may not be necessary for a computer engineer to have a complete understanding of web design, gaining some knowledge of web development and design may have its advantages.

Computer Engineer: Necessary Web Design Knowledge

Computer Engineer: Necessary Web Design Knowledge

Focus on Specific Areas

Computer engineering is a broad field of expertise. It encompasses topics ranging from hardware, networking, software, and security. For someone interested in web design, there are a few specific areas that should be focused on. This knowledge is necessary to understand how every component works together when creating a website.

Hardware and Networking

Hardware and networking form the backbone of all computers, and a web designer should be comfortable working with both. Knowledge of the different components of a computer, such as the processor, motherboard, memory, bus, and ports is essential. Additionally, a basic understanding of configure a Local Area Network (LAN) and troubleshooting network issues is also beneficial.

Software Development

Having a knowledge of programming is a must for any web designer. While an in-depth knowledge of all languages is not necessary, it’s important to have a general understanding of the fundamentals of coding, and a great deal of experience with at least one programming language. HTML, CSS, and JavaScript are three of the most commonly used languages for web design, and knowledge of each will provide a great foundation for a web designer.


Given the growing threats posed by cyber attacks, security is an important topic for any web designer. Having a knowledge of the different threats, such as SQL injection, XSS, and CSRF, is essential for ensuring the security of the website. Additionally, understanding concepts such as authentication, encryption, and firewalls will help ensure the website is safe from malicious attacks.

Web Design

Finally, web designers need to focus more on the actual design of the website as well. Having a good sense of aesthetics is important, and having a good understanding of user experience principles like navigation, readability, and responsiveness will help ensure the website is able to perform at a high-level.

  • Hardware and Networking: Familiarity with the different components of a computer and configuring a basic Network.
  • Software Development: A general understanding of programming languages and knowledge of HTML, CSS, and JavaScript.
  • Security: Knowledge of security threats and concepts such as authentication, encryption, and firewalls.
  • Web Design: Good sense of aesthetics and a knowledge of user experience principles.

As a computer engineer, having a good understanding of the web design process is essential. A web designer should be knowledgeable of the different areas of computer engineering and should also have a general understanding of the fundamentals of programming. Finally, they should have a firm grasp of the security principles and user experience elements. All of these components together will enable computer engineers to create highly functioning and secure websites.

Unlocking the Potential of Computer Engineering with Web Design

Advantages of Combining Computer Engineering and Web Design

As technological advancement continues to move forward, many companies are seeking innovative and effective ways to leverage the potential of computer engineering and web design. Is it truly possible to unlock the combination of these two distinct, yet related, fields to achieve greater efficiency and drive results? On further exploration, the answer is a definitive yes.

The Benefits of Merging Both Resources

One of the most appealing advantages of incorporating computer engineering and web design is the potential to create an enhanced user experience. With the right level of skill and expertise, computer engineers are able to bridge the gap between the technical and creative, allowing them to design platforms that optimally showcase web-based content. This is due to their adeptness in working with data and information architecture, as well as their grasp of aesthetics such as typography and user interface design.
Moreover, combining the two disciplines affords professionals better access to complex coding and data processing. People who are capable of positioning both areas of expertise against one another can take advantage of technologies skewed towards synthetic and machine learning. This helps them to create a more comprehensive and detailed experience for web visitors.

Maximizing Potential Through Technical Expertise

Given the complexity of computer engineering and web design, it is essential to have a foundational understanding of both of them. Professionals need to be aware of the language needed when working with coding, as well as the principles of data engineering, in order to ensure the efficiency of a project. The same goes for interactive and visual design, as developers should be able to effectively utilize digital media and interactive elements to create the most optimal experience for visitors.
At the same time, professionals should also be aware of the data generated by users on the web. Through collecting and analyzing customer data, they can gain insights into customer behaviour, preferences and attitudes. This helps them to create more user-friendly experiences by accounting for customer needs.
In conclusion, this fusion of engineering and web design is a powerful combination that can lead to a positive customer experience and drive business results. Companies stand to benefit from tapping into the potential of computer engineering and web design, for with skill and expertise, this combination aims to set a new industry standard for digital success.

Maximizing Benefits of Computer Engineering through Web Design Expertise

Maximizing Benefits of Computer Engineering through Web Design Expertise

In this digital age, it has become increasingly important for computer engineers to acquire web design knowledge to maximize their effectiveness in the field. Experienced computer engineers who wish to stay competitive often find themselves looking to add more knowledge and skills to their repertoire. The addition of web design skills can open new doors and enhance opportunities for maximizing career benefits.

Revealing the Benefits of Web Design

What are some of the benefits that a computer engineer can gain from acquiring web design skills? Web design skills are useful for creating specific tools that can facilitate communication between two parties. Additionally, with web design experience, a computer engineer could build useful applications and tools that allow for interactive information. Furthermore, web design skills can help the engineer to better visualize the framework of a project and present a clear and detailed roadmap.

The Keys to Acquiring Relevant Web Design Knowledge

What is the best way for computer engineers to maximize their web design skills? One key component is to stay up-to-date on the latest coding languages and tools that are available in the market. Additionally, computer engineers should strive to collaborate with UI/UX designers to learn effective techniques for design. Another effective approach is to take an online course that provides computer engineering students with an introduction to web design. Having prior experience in coding and debugging can also help expedite the learning process.
Moreover, there are ample opportunities to attend web development conferences, workshops, and seminars to stay up to date with the industry’s latest trends. Aspiring web developers can also sign up for an online web portfolio and showcase their best works to attract potential employers. The combination of the aforementioned techniques and opportunities can help computer engineers attain the desired level of web design expertise.
Thought-provoking question: Could web design skills help unlock new opportunities for computer engineers? The answer is yes, web design skills present a wide range of possibilities for computer engineers to take their career to the next level. Additionally, there are plenty of tools and resources available to help computer engineers acquire the relevant web design knowledge. With the correct approach, a computer engineer can confidently take on the challenge of mastering web design and reap the many benefits.


The debate as to whether computer engineers must know web design is a hotly contested one. While many might suggest that these two fields of expertise are unnecessary in tandem, the reality is that a knowledge of both can often significantly benefit the employer. But what is the bottom line – is it a valuable combination or not? This is a thought-provoking question that is worth deeper exploration.
With the ever-evolving landscape of technology, an engineer’s understanding of web design is essential. Web designers are tasked with creating attractive websites and web-based applications that must be optimized for use on multiple devices. In order to do this, they must be knowledgeable in a range of coding languages, such as HTML, CSS, and JavaScript, as well as consideration for the user interface. For the most part, engineers hold the development skills that would enable them to make the most of these tools, and thus create the best platform.
In the competitive industry of computer engineering, developing an added edge by diversifying your services and understanding of modern technologies is certainly an advantageous pursuit. At the same time, it is worth considering that such a move requires a significant level of dedication and investment of your time to stay abreast of the changes. If you’re interested in the idea, why not take the plunge and begin your journey in learning web design? Make sure you follow our blog to stay up to date with the latest web technology trends, as well as for all the information you need to start you off on the right path. We’ll have new releases and tips available soon!


Q1: Is computer engineering a prerequisite for becoming a web designer?
A1: No, computer engineering is not a necessary requirement for becoming a web designer, as one can learn the necessary skills through industry courses and self-study. Furthermore, web design requires knowledge in areas such as content writing, graphic design, and user interface design, which are not necessarily part of computer engineering.
Q2: What knowledge areas does a computer engineer need to be proficient in for web design?
A2: Computer engineers who wish to become web design professionals should be familiar with HTML and CSS coding, as well as graphic design and UX/UI principles. It is also essential to understand how to use relevant web design-oriented software such as Adobe Creative Cloud.
Q3: Is taking an online course for web design enough to become a computer engineer?
A3: While taking an online course can help provide the basic knowledge needed to become a web designer, additional experience in the field will prove beneficial. Professional experience is highly sought after by employers, so to better prepare for a role in computer engineering, taking on relevant projects, internship opportunities, and participating in industry workshops is recommended.
Q4: What is the biggest challenge that a computer engineer may face when designing websites?
A4: One of the biggest challenges for computer engineers when designing websites is creating websites that are not only aesthetically pleasing, but that are also optimized for speed, user experience, device compatibility, and other web performance standards. Additionally, computer engineers may need to work with back-end technologies such as databases and server-side languages in order to create a functional site.
Q5: What are the most important skills that a computer engineer should have when designing websites?
A5: A few of the most essential skills for any computer engineer engaging in web design include problem-solving abilities, creativity, an aptitude for learning, understanding of best practices, and the willingness to keep up with industry trends It is also important to have the ability to design a visually pleasing website, successfully implement website features, and test and optimize websites for usability and performance.